Circle U. announces call for research prize

Researchers working on inter- or transdisciplinary projects may apply by 10 May.

Designed to showcase best examples of inter- and transdisciplinary research at Circle U. universities, this prize is going to be awarded annually, as of this year, to three scholars and/or research teams who will be evaluated by a multidisciplinary panel of Circle U. academics and external partners with experience in inter- and transdisciplinarity. This initiative is co-funded by the European Union’s Horizon 2020 Research and Innovation Programme.

This is a unique opportunity for researchers and PhD candidates to raise the visibility of their research projects, and to showcase their work through a promotional video produced by professionals.

The ICUP will be awarded at a ceremony during the conference on interdisciplinary and transdisciplinary research for sustainable development, to be hosted at the Université catholique de Louvain on 25 November, 2022.
